SkyClaw : Runtime d'agent IA autonome basé sur Rust

✍️ OpenClawRadar📅 Publié: March 9, 2026🔗 Source
SkyClaw : Runtime d'agent IA autonome basé sur Rust
Ad

SkyClaw est un runtime d'agent IA autonome construit en Rust avec 40 000 lignes de code, conçu comme un système souverain et auto-réparateur qui fonctionne indéfiniment sans intervention manuelle. Le projet met l'accent sur cinq principes d'ingénierie fondamentaux plutôt que sur des listes de fonctionnalités.

Architecture technique

Le système se divise en deux zones architecturales distinctes :

  • Le code dur : Infrastructure Rust pour le réseau, la persistance et la gestion des processus. Ce composant doit être correct, minimal, rapide, sûr au niveau des types, sûr au niveau de la mémoire, avec zéro comportement indéfini.
  • Le cœur agentique : Moteur de raisonnement piloté par LLM avec 20 modules couvrant la décomposition des tâches, l'auto-correction, l'apprentissage inter-tâches et les boucles de vérification. C'est l'architecture cognitive où réside l'intelligence.

Benchmarks de performance

  • Taille du binaire : 7,1 Mo (binaire statique unique sans dépendances d'exécution)
  • Utilisation de la RAM au repos : 14 Mo (contre 800 Mo–3 Go pour les agents TypeScript typiques)
  • Temps de démarrage : Moins d'une seconde (contre 5–15 minutes pour d'autres frameworks)
Ad

Cinq principes d'ingénierie

1. Autonomie

SkyClaw ne refuse pas le travail et n'abandonne pas. Lorsque les tâches échouent, les échecs deviennent de nouvelles informations plutôt que des conditions d'arrêt. Le système décompose la complexité, réessaie avec des approches alternatives, substitue des outils et s'auto-répare. Il ne s'arrête que pour une impossibilité démontrée, pas pour la difficulté, le coût ou la fatigue.

2. Robustesse

Conçu pour un déploiement indéfini sans dégradation. Quand il plante, il redémarre. Quand les outils cassent, il se reconnecte. Quand les fournisseurs tombent, il bascule. Quand l'état est corrompu, il se reconstruit à partir du stockage durable. Chaque composant suppose que l'échec est constant, avec des connexions vérifiées, des délais d'attente, des nouvelles tentatives et des relances automatiques.

3. Élégance

L'architecture se sépare en deux zones avec des standards différents : l'infrastructure Rust doit être correcte et minimale, tandis que le cœur agentique doit être innovant, adaptatif et extensible.

4. Efficacité brutale

Les prompts système sont compressés au minimum qui préserve la qualité. Les fenêtres de contexte sont gérées chirurgicalement. L'historique des conversations est élagué avec intention—conservant les décisions tout en éliminant le bruit. Chaque token envoyé au LLM doit porter de l'information.

5. Boucle opérationnelle du cœur agentique

COMMANDE → RÉFLÉCHIR → ACTION → VÉRIFIER → TERMINÉ

  • COMMANDE : Une directive arrive ; si elle est composée, elle est décomposée en graphe de tâches
  • RÉFLÉCHIR : L'agent raisonne sur l'état actuel, l'objectif et les outils disponibles (structuré, pas libre)
  • ACTION : Exécution via des outils incluant le shell, le navigateur, les opérations sur fichiers, les appels API, git, la messagerie
  • VÉRIFIER : Après chaque action, l'agent confirme explicitement le résultat avec des preuves concrètes (sortie de commande, contenu de fichier, réponses HTTP)
  • TERMINÉ : L'achèvement est un état mesurable avec l'objectif atteint, le résultat vérifié, les artefacts livrés

Déploiement et utilisation

Pas de tableaux de bord web, de fichiers de configuration à éditer manuellement, d'Electron ou de node_modules. Vous déployez le binaire unique, collez votre clé API dans Telegram, et vous vous éloignez. Le système prend le relais.

En pratique, vous envoyez un message à votre bot sur Telegram avec des commandes comme "Déploie l'application, exécute les migrations, vérifie la santé et fais un rapport."

📖 Lire la source complète : r/openclaw

Ad

👀 See Also

Plateforme IA de Cloudflare : Couche d'Inférence Unifiée pour les Agents IA
Tools

Plateforme IA de Cloudflare : Couche d'Inférence Unifiée pour les Agents IA

La plateforme IA de Cloudflare fournit une API unique pour accéder à plus de 70 modèles provenant de plus de 12 fournisseurs, incluant une prise en charge multimodale pour les modèles d'image, vidéo et parole. Elle permet de changer de modèle avec une seule modification de code et offre une surveillance centralisée des coûts avec des métadonnées personnalisées.

OpenClawRadar
OpenClaw contre Hermès : Choisissez le bon agent IA auto-hébergé après plus de 100 déploiements
Tools

OpenClaw contre Hermès : Choisissez le bon agent IA auto-hébergé après plus de 100 déploiements

Après avoir déployé plus de 100 agents IA pour des clients, un utilisateur de Reddit partage ses leçons durement acquises : OpenClaw (149K étoiles) est le cheval de bataille fiable pour les flottes simples/petites ; Hermes excelle dans l'orchestration multi-agents mais a une communauté plus petite.

OpenClawRadar
Claude Code Skill Convertit les Designs Stitch en Next.js sans Dérive de Pixel
Tools

Claude Code Skill Convertit les Designs Stitch en Next.js sans Dérive de Pixel

Une compétence Claude Code convertit les designs Google Stitch AI en composants Next.js avec des points de contrôle de vérification obligatoires pour éviter le décalage de pixels, préservant les valeurs exactes et gérant les ressources.

OpenClawRadar
Les utilisateurs rapportent une valeur mitigée d'OpenClaw et ClawDBot : ce que vous devez savoir
Tools

Les utilisateurs rapportent une valeur mitigée d'OpenClaw et ClawDBot : ce que vous devez savoir

OpenClaw et ClawDBot, bien que prometteurs en tant qu'outils d'IA pour l'automatisation du code, ont laissé certains utilisateurs déçus. Cet article explore les principaux enseignements d'une discussion Reddit sur les expériences utilisateur et la valeur tirée de ces plateformes.

OpenClawRadar